Output 3407d07ef0ff25d92c1f513b3b9fc12c7c87a1ed2f3fe12fbf12dafafc6c10ef:0

value
656706079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d018ae37939f2cfedc15310677d677715fc6a20b OP_EQUAL
address
MSsUMAVvanLG5qkJco5Q9ym5eXJmuea2kT
transaction
3407d07ef0ff25d92c1f513b3b9fc12c7c87a1ed2f3fe12fbf12dafafc6c10ef
spent
true